- THE DAJJAL — The Greatest Fitnah
His Current Location
“He is on an island, chained, and Tamim Ad-Dari met him there.” — Sahih Muslim 2942
∙ The Prophet ﷺ said Dajjal is currently imprisoned on an island in the sea
∙ Tamim Ad-Dari (a companion) physically met him before accepting Islam — and the Prophet ﷺ confirmed his account
∙ He is chained, waiting for Allah’s permission to be released
∙ He knows time is passing and asks about the Prophet ﷺ and whether he has appeared yet
His Physical Description in Detail
Feature Description Eyes Right eye blind — like a floating grape; left eye also has weakness Forehead Wide and prominent Complexion Reddish-white skin Hair Curly and thick Build Short and stocky Written on forehead ك ف ر (K-F-R) — readable by every believer, literate or not Movement Travels on a giant mule that covers vast distances in strides
“His right eye is blind and his left eye is not blind but is thick and protruding like a grape.” — Sahih Muslim 169
His Emergence
∙ Will emerge from the East, from Khurasan (modern Iran/Central Asia region)
∙ 70,000 Jews of Isfahan will follow him wearing green shawls — Sahih Muslim 2944
∙ Will first claim to be a righteous man, then a Prophet, then finally claim to be God
∙ His emergence will be during a time of:
∙ Severe drought and famine (for 3 years before his appearance)
∙ Year 1: Sky withholds 1/3 of rain, earth withholds 1/3 of produce
∙ Year 2: 2/3 withheld
∙ Year 3: Complete drought — yet people and animals somehow survive
His Powers & Tricks
- Control over Rain and Vegetation
“He will pass by ruins and say ‘bring out your treasures’ — and they will follow him like swarms of bees.” — Muslim 2934
∙ Commands the sky to rain → it rains
∙ Commands earth to grow → it grows
∙ This is istidraj — a test, not a miracle from Allah - His “Paradise” and “Hellfire”
“With him will be a paradise and hellfire. His hellfire is paradise and his paradise is hellfire.” — Bukhari 7130
∙ What appears as paradise is actually hellfire
∙ Believers who are thrown into his “fire” will find it cool and peaceful
∙ A key test of true faith - Killing and Reviving
∙ Will appear to kill a young man and then bring him back to life
∙ That young man will actually be Al-Khidr according to some scholars, or a specific believer
∙ After this “revival” the young man will say: “Now I am more certain than ever that you are the Dajjal”
∙ Dajjal will try to kill him again but will not be able to — Allah protects him - Traveling the Entire Earth
“He will go through every land except Makkah and Madinah.” — Bukhari 1882
∙ Will traverse the entire earth in 40 days
∙ Day 1 = like a year in length
∙ Day 2 = like a month
∙ Day 3 = like a week
∙ Remaining days = normal length
Protected Places
∙ Makkah — Angels guard every entrance
∙ Madinah — Will shake 3 times, expelling all hypocrites to Dajjal; only true believers remain
∙ Masjid Al-Aqsa (under siege but spiritually protected)
∙ Mount Tur (Sinai)
How to Protect Yourself from Dajjal - Surah Al-Kahf
“Whoever memorizes the first ten verses of Surah Al-Kahf will be protected from the Dajjal.” — Sahih Muslim 809
The connection: Surah Al-Kahf tells the story of young men who held firm to faith against an oppressive king — a parallel to standing firm against Dajjal - Specific Dua in Every Salah
“Allahumma inni a’udhu bika min adhabil qabr, wa min adhabi jahannam, wa min fitnatil mahya wal mamat, wa min sharri fitnatil masihid dajjal”
(O Allah, I seek refuge in You from the punishment of the grave, the punishment of hellfire, the trials of life and death, and the evil trial of the False Messiah) - Stay Far from Him
“Whoever hears of the Dajjal, let him keep far from him. By Allah, a man will come to him thinking he is a believer and end up following him due to the doubts he raises.” — Abu Dawud 4319
His Death
∙ Isa ﷺ will descend and pursue the Dajjal
∙ Dajjal will begin to dissolve like salt in water just from the breath of Isa ﷺ
∙ Isa ﷺ will catch him at the Gate of Ludd (Lod, Palestine) and kill him with his spear
∙ Believers will see the blood on the spear — ultimate proof he was mortal - THE MAHDI — The Guided Leader
His Lineage & Identity
“The Mahdi is from my family, from the descendants of Fatimah.” — Abu Dawud 4284
∙ Full name: Muhammad ibn Abdullah
∙ From Ahlul Bayt — specifically descendants of Sayyida Fatimah ﷺ through Hasan ibn Ali
∙ Will have:
∙ High forehead
∙ Slightly curved nose (aquiline)
∙ Will be middle-aged in appearance when he emerges
His Emergence — The Circumstances
The Situation Before His Coming:
∙ The Muslim world will be in a state of extreme division and chaos
∙ A massive civil war in the Arab world — scholars refer to narrations about conflicts near Syria/Iraq
∙ Three men will fight over the Caliphate, all sons of Caliphs — none will succeed
∙ A black flag army will emerge from Khurasan
“If you see the black flags coming from Khurasan, join that army, even if you have to crawl over snow.” — Ibn Majah (debated authenticity — scholars urge caution)
His Appearance:
∙ Will appear suddenly — even he himself may not know he is the Mahdi initially
∙ People will pledge allegiance (bay’ah) to him near the Kaaba, between the Rukn (Black Stone corner) and Maqam Ibrahim
∙ He will initially resist — being humble, not seeking power
∙ An army sent to stop him will be swallowed by the earth in the desert
“An army will be sent against him and will be swallowed up in the desert between Makkah and Madinah.” — Muslim 2882
His Rule & Achievements
Justice and Prosperity:
“He will fill the earth with equity and justice as it had been filled with oppression and tyranny.” — Abu Dawud 4283
∙ Will rule for 7, 8, or 9 years (different narrations — possibly 7-9 years total)
∙ Will distribute wealth without counting
“A man will come to him asking for money and he will say ‘take’ and fill his garment” — Muslim 2913
∙ Under his rule, the earth will bring out its blessings — agriculture will be unprecedented
∙ The Ummah will be united under one leadership for the first time in centuries
Military Victories:
∙ Will lead Muslims in conquering Constantinople (Istanbul) — Sahih Muslim 2920
“The city will be conquered… they will say Allahu Akbar and one of its walls will fall”
∙ Will prepare the army against the Dajjal
∙ Isa ﷺ will descend and pray Salah behind him — a profound moment of honor
The Moment Isa ﷺ Arrives:
“Isa ibn Maryam will descend and their leader (Mahdi) will say: ‘Come, lead us in prayer.’ But Isa will say: ‘No, your leader should lead, as Allah has honored this Ummah.’” — Ibn Majah 4077
This is one of the most moving narrations — Isa ﷺ, a Prophet of Allah, will defer to the Mahdi in prayer, honoring the Ummah of Muhammad ﷺ.
Common Misconceptions About the Mahdi
Misconception Reality He will declare himself publicly He will be recognized by others, not self-proclaimed He is hidden and will return (Shia view) Sunni view: he has not yet been born or is unknown Any leader with reform = Mahdi His signs are very specific — name, lineage, circumstances Black flags = definitely Mahdi’s army This hadith’s chain is weak — scholars urge caution
- ISA (JESUS) ﷺ — His Second Coming & Life on Earth
What Happened to Isa ﷺ — The Quran’s Position
“They did not kill him, nor did they crucify him — but it was made to appear so to them.” — Quran 4:157
“Allah raised him up to Himself.” — Quran 4:158
∙ Isa ﷺ was NOT crucified — a substitute was made to appear like him
∙ He was raised alive to the heavens — body and soul
∙ He is alive with Allah right now, waiting to descend
∙ His descent is one of the most certain major signs
The Descent — Every Detail
Where & How:
“Isa ibn Maryam will descend near the white minaret in the east of Damascus, wearing two garments dyed with saffron, placing his hands on the wings of two angels.” — Sahih Muslim 2937
∙ Location: White minaret, east of Damascus, Syria
∙ Appearance:
∙ Wearing saffron-yellow/reddish garments
∙ Hair wet — as if just came from a bath
∙ Supported by two angels
∙ When he lowers his head, water drips — when he raises it, water flows like pearls
The Timing:
∙ Will descend during the time of the Mahdi
∙ Muslims will be gathered for Fajr prayer
∙ Isa ﷺ will arrive just as the Iqamah is called
∙ Mahdi will invite him to lead — Isa ﷺ will pray behind the Mahdi
∙ After Salah — the hunt for Dajjal begins immediately
His Mission After Descent - Killing the Dajjal
∙ Will pursue Dajjal who flees like salt dissolving
∙ Catches him at Bab Ludd (Lod, Palestine)
∙ One thrust of his spear — Dajjal is finished
∙ Shows the blood to the people — the greatest fitnah is over - Breaking the Cross
“By the One in Whose Hand is my soul, the son of Maryam will soon descend among you as a just judge. He will break the cross, kill the pig…” — Bukhari 2222
∙ Breaks the cross — symbolically ending the distortion of his message (that he was crucified/divine)
∙ Kills the swine — abolishes what was made lawful in distorted Christianity
∙ Abolishes the Jizyah — because everyone will accept Islam
∙ Every People of the Book will believe in him before his death — Quran 4:159 - Leading the World in Justice
∙ Will rule by the Sharia of Muhammad ﷺ — not a new law
∙ Will not be a Prophet bringing new revelation — he follows the Quran and Sunnah
∙ The world will experience unprecedented peace and harmony
∙ Even wild animals and humans will coexist peacefully
“The lion will live with the camel, the leopard with the cow…” — related narrations - Dealing with Ya’juj and Ma’juj
∙ After Dajjal’s death, Ya’juj and Ma’juj are unleashed
∙ Their numbers are so vast that no army can fight them
∙ Isa ﷺ and the believers retreat to Mount Tur
∙ Isa ﷺ makes dua to Allah against them
∙ Allah sends worms (An-Naghaf) — a type of creature — into their necks
∙ All of Ya’juj and Ma’juj die in one night
∙ Earth is cleansed — narrations describe birds disposing of their bodies
∙ The earth then brings out its blessings and barakah - His Personal Life on Earth “He will live on earth for 40 years, then die, and the Muslims will pray over him.” — Abu Dawud 4324 ∙ Will marry — scholars mention he will have children ∙ Will perform Hajj and/or Umrah ∙ Will visit the grave of Prophet Muhammad ﷺ in Madinah and offer salaam “He will visit my grave and I will respond to his salaam” — Abu Dawud (some scholars authenticate this) ∙ Will eventually die a natural death ∙ Will be buried next to the Prophet ﷺ in Madinah — a spot reportedly already reserved The Profound Wisdom of Isa’s ﷺ Return Islamic scholars highlight several deep wisdoms:
- Completion of his mission — he was taken before his work was done; he returns to complete it
- Vindication — the world will see he was neither crucified nor divine, but a noble Prophet
- Unity of the Abrahamic message — the final unification under Tawheed
- The honor of this Ummah — even a Prophet prays behind the Mahdi of Ummah Muhammad ﷺ
- Allah’s justice — Dajjal, the greatest deceiver, is killed by Isa ﷺ, the one he most misrepresented
